    Section 2: Opinions of Gun Owners, Non-Gun Owners

    People in non-gun-owning households have more positive views about the possible impact of stricter gun laws than those who live in a household with a gun. Majorities of those in non-gun households say that stricter gun laws would reduce deaths from mass shootings (66%) and accidents (65%), and would keep guns away from criminals (63%). […]

    Tea Party’s Image Turns More Negative

    Survey Report The Tea Party is less popular than ever, with even many Republicans now viewing the movement negatively. Overall, nearly half of the public (49%) has an unfavorable opinion of the Tea Party, while 30% have a favorable opinion.
